TWO people were arrested tonight (Wednesday, February 6) after what police say was a large disturbance at an East Cleveland pub.
Officers were called to the Kingfisher Hotel on Farndale Square, Redcar, at 6.20pm.
A spokesman for Cleveland Police said the two were held on suspicion of being drunk and disorderly.
The manager of the hotel was contacted for details, but declined to comment.
